Property Description for 34-37 80th Street, 52

Be the first to enjoy this completely renovated three-bedroom/two-bathroom top floor home in the legendary Chateau, the pre-war masterpiece designed by Andrew J. Thomas. Renovated from floor to ceiling, this stunning apartment honors its heritage while offering every contemporary comfort. Refinished wood floors with inlays stretch the length of the massive open living/dining room area complete with a wood-burning fireplace and five oversized windows. The kitchen is a cook's dream offering a Bertazzoni convection oven with induction cooktop and professional range hood, Bosch refrigerator, dishwasher, and microwave, soapstone counters and integrated farmhouse sink with Perrin & Roe faucet. All new soft-close cabinetry is accented by brass handles and pulls, and the entire room is flooded with light from two south facing windows. Three large bedrooms and a fully renovated bathroom with bathtub are accessed from a long hallway off the delightful entry foyer. All of the bedrooms are perfectly positioned in the back of the apartment to take advantage of the quiet provided by the Chateau's magnificent block-long private garden. The primary bedroom easily accommodates a King-sized bed with night tables and has two garden-facing windows facing south and east. A windowed ensuite bathroom has been beautifully retiled to include a waterfall shower head with handheld, new pedestal sink and toilet, and a lighted medicine chest. A second bedroom also has two garden-facing windows with eastern and northern exposures. Shown with twin beds, this gracious room can also accommodate a Queen bed with night tables and dresser. The third bedroom features charming silver birch wallpaper and a window with northeastern exposures. Original pre-war features have all been refreshed and enhanced including the magnificent hardwood floors with inlays, 9' ceilings, moldings, oversized windows, and the surround of the wood burning fireplace. New light fixtures blend with new recessed lighting, door handles are made of crystal and brass, and wallpaper accent walls add charm and whimsy. There is a laundry room, bike storage, and private personal storage (included with the apartment at no charge) in the basement which can be accessed via the elevator. There is a live-in super. Cats and dogs allowed. Building requires 25% down payment and board approval. Subletting not permitted. No flip tax. There is a quarterly assessment of $1175. Prime location in the center of the Jackson Heights’ Historic District and close to all services, transportation and airports. Note: images virtually staged.

Jackson Heights | Queens

Quick Profile

Jackson Heights has one of the most diverse populations in the city, and over 100 languages are spoken here. With this cultural diversity comes supporting restaurants, bars, shops and cultural opportunities. It is a mix of commercial and residential properties. There is a wide range of shops and service businesses, so that anything you would need, from a barber, to a pharmacy, to clothing, and food is available right in the neighborhood, no matter which culture or language you might need these services provided in. 

Jackson Heights has three nicknames, based on micro-neighborhoods with the neighborhood as a whole. Little India occupies an area on 74th Street, while parts of 73rd Street are known as Little Pakistan. Little Columbia is along 37th Avenue.

A large portion of Jackson Heights has been designated as an historic district, from Roosevelt Avenue to Northern Boulevard, between the east side of 76th Street to the west side of 88th Street.

Jackson Heights was a planned community, where the first “garden apartments” were created in buildings constructed around central gardens and green spaces that gave neighbors a place to meet and socialize with one another, created places for children to play, allowing light to come into the apartments and air to flow freely through them. These gardens are private and only residents have access to them. Passing by the buildings, you might not even guess the gardens were there, as they are not generally visible from the street. 

Additionally, there are some mid-rise apartment buildings. Some of these are rentals, some are co-ops, and some are condos. There are a few attached row houses that provide housing for one to three families. 

As much as Jackson Heights might be full of noise and mix of cultures, it also has a quieter side, where the various cultures mix and mingle and learn about each other against a backdrop of beautiful architecture and a culinary landscape that brings the world to Queens.
